Vertigo – Petite Friture

Origin and concept

History: Designed by Constance Guisset for her graduation project, the Vertigo suspension became an icon as soon as it was released in 2010. It seduced Amélie du Passage, founder of Petite Friture, who took the risk of publishing this unusual luminaire despite the initial reluctance of publishers.

Concept: Described by Guisset as a “cabin lamp”, Vertigo combines lightness, movement and intimacy. It creates a graphic, transparent space that moves with the air currents, evoking a sensation of floating. The aim was to design a large-scale suspension (up to 2 meters in diameter) that would still be aerial.

Vertigo – Petite Friture

Technical data

Materials: Ultra-light structure in fiberglass and steel, with hand-laid polyurethane ribbons for a velvety feel. The cable is in textile mesh, and the lampholder in steel.

Care: Light cleaning with a feather duster or soft, slightly damp cloth for thorough cleaning.

Vertigo – Petite Friture

Aesthetics and visual impact

Design: The enveloping structure of the polyurethane ribbons creates a play of shadows projected onto the ceiling, offering an intimate, poetic ambience. Its fluid movement, reacting to air currents, adds a dynamic dimension.

Adaptability: Vertigo fits into both large and small spaces, thanks to its three sizes and its ability to be height-adjustable.

Museums and collections: Exhibited by gallery owner Rossana Orlandi in Milan, Vertigo is part of the permanent collections of MoMA (New York), MAD (Paris) and Le Cap.

Awards: Awarded the Prix du Public at Villa Noailles in 2006 and the Grand Prix du Design de la Ville de Paris in 2008.

Vertigo – Petite Friture

Social commitment

Manufacturing: Produced in France by APF France Handicap, a choice made in 2010 reflecting Petite Friture's ambition to “bring out the good in the beautiful”. More than 30 craftsmen produce these luminaires with meticulous care, reinforcing the brand's social commitment.

Ethics: Local production respects rigorous standards, reduces carbon footprint and supports the French economy.

Petite Friture: a bold, poetic and contemporary expression of French design

A design house driven by creativity and artistic freedom

Founded in 2009, Petite Friture is a French brand committed to supporting emerging designers and nurturing expressive creation. The brand offers objects that inspire emotion, curiosity and beauty through a fresh, modern and imaginative design approach.

A graphic, airy and characterful aesthetic

Petite Friture designs are instantly recognisable through their sculptural lines, light silhouettes and refined colour palettes. The style is both joyful and audacious, bringing personality and visual poetry to any interior. This strong identity has earned the brand international acclaim.

Iconic lighting pieces that have become contemporary classics

The Vertigo pendant by Constance Guisset has become an icon of modern design, reflecting Petite Friture signature blend of movement, lightness and graphic beauty. Other designs such as Lanterna, Aura and Cherry further expand the poetic and playful identity of the brand.
